## Idempotency Keys for Payment Retries (Lumopay)

Every retry of a charge request must reuse the original idempotency key; generating a new key on retry can produce duplicate charges. Keys are scoped per merchant and expire after 48 hours. Reviewers should verify keys are derived server-side, never from client input. The full key-generation specification and threat model are maintained on the internal page.

dashboard of kaguf-tawip = https://vault.merlaqsys.test/issue

Ticket #—Locked vault blocking pagination fix

The Coverly API team cannot ship the public REST pagination patch (cursor tokens were expiring mid-page) because the deploy credentials live in the Ironhollow vault, which auto-locked after three failed attempts during last night's rotation. Support: customers reporting duplicate page results should be told a fix is staged. To unlock the vault and release the patch, enter the recovery passphrase shown below.

vault phrase of bagaf-kajeg = jorath-feniel-briir-siliel-ralix

## Formula sandbox tuning

User-supplied formulas in Gridmoor execute inside a restricted interpreter with hard ceilings on time, memory, and call depth. Reviewers should confirm any change to these ceilings is justified in the PR description, since raising them widens the abuse surface. Defaults were chosen from production traces. The current limits are as follows.

limits module of tafog-fawip:
WEIGHTS = {
    "julix": 57,
    "lamys": 992,
    "kasvan": 209,
    "quenok": 750,
    "alddor": 259,
    "oliath": 1009,
    "wenix": 815,
}

### Step 6: Enable the bloom filter

Deploy the Sievegate bloom filter ahead of the Cobblestore key-value tier. Warm it from last night's snapshot before routing traffic, or miss rates will spike. Confirm the false-positive rate stays under 1% in the Larkview dashboard. Verify the signed filter bundle with the key below.

release key, fajef-kajeg: bky19_LdLu6Ne6FLi8he2c24d